嵌入式测试工程师面试的核心考察点包括硬件/软件协同测试能力、自动化脚本编写经验、缺陷定位思维,以及RTOS/低功耗等专项场景的测试方法论。 以下是分点详解:
-
基础理论考察
高频问题如“嵌入式系统上电失败的可能原因”需分维度回答:硬件侧检查供电/晶振/复位电路,软件侧排查Bootloader逻辑或Flash烧录异常。类似题目常结合看门狗机制、中断处理流程(如现场保护与优先级嵌套)等核心概念。 -
代码与调试实战
手撕代码题可能涉及内存操作(如大小端判断、位域操作)或协议解析(UART/I2C数据校验)。调试类问题需展示工具链使用经验,如通过JTAG抓取异常时序、利用逻辑分析仪定位信号冲突。 -
自动化测试框架
企业关注Python/Robot Framework等脚本化测试能力,需举例说明如何设计模块化测试用例,或通过CI/CD实现持续集成。对HIL(硬件在环)测试等专业方法也需简要阐述。 -
行业场景适配
车载领域需强调CAN总线测试、EMC抗干扰验证;物联网设备需关注低功耗测试策略(如休眠电流波形分析)。部分面试会要求分析特定场景的测试用例设计思路。 -
软技能与质量意识
缺陷管理工具(如JIRA)的使用、测试报告撰写规范、以及与开发团队的协作流程,都是评估工程师综合能力的关键项。
建议候选人提前梳理真实项目案例,用“问题-方法-结果”结构展示技术闭环能力,同时关注最新测试工具(如基于AI的异常检测)以体现技术前瞻性。